Samuel v. Frank, 07-1243

In a prosecution for sexual assault of a minor, denial of habeas corpus relief is affirmed over claims that the court inappropriately admitted testimony which the police had allegedly coerced from the minor by threatening to keep the minor away from her newborn child.
